About Converting Centigrams per Cubic Millimeter to Short tons per Milliliter
Centigram per Cubic Millimeter and Short ton per Milliliter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
short tons per milliliter = centigrams per cubic millimeter × 0.0000110231131092
This factor comes from each unit's defined relationship to the category's base unit: 1 centigram per cubic millimeter equals 10000 base units, and 1 short ton per milliliter equals 907184740 base units, so dividing one by the other gives the direct centigram per cubic millimeter-to-short ton per milliliter factor of 0.0000110231131092.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
